Because most of the time when the car is already on the lot the dealer wants sticker price (MSRP) and sometimes even more. When I went car shopping locally all the dealers wanted like $1,000-$2,000 over sticker price.

I ended up ordering one from a dealer in NJ and paid $500 under invoice which is about $2,000 UNDER the sticker price.
